Life after Debt Settlement

So you have completed a debt settlement program and you are now debt free. No more harassing phone calls from credit card companies, and a lot less stress. But what’s next? Just because you have erased all of your unsecured debt doesn’t necessarily mean that you are going to stay that way. It is imperative that you learn from any mistakes that you made and become aware of the reasons why you went into debt. Without a thorough understanding of how your debt got out of hand, you will not be able to avoid debt in the future.

Debt settlement is a great choice for debt resolution, and although it cannot guarantee that your finances will stay in the black, the process itself does equip you with some tools to help guard against debt. When you enroll in our debt settlement program, your personal debt settlement coach will analyze your financial situation and create a budget for you to follow during the duration of the debt settlement program. But with a few adjustments, this budget can work for your life after credit card debt settlement as well. Having your money specifically allocated ensures that you won’t overspend.

One of the few disadvantages of participating in a debt settlement program is that it might have a negative effect on your credit score. This occurs because you have to stop paying your creditors during debt settlement in order for it to be successful. The end result, being complete debt relief, is great for your credit, but it may take awhile for you to build a better score. Although your credit score might be unfavorable after debt settlement, it will only affect you if you try to obtain more credit. This is probably not the best idea after completing a debt settlement program. It is wise to limit credit cards and only pay unavoidable loans, such as a mortgage. Too much available credit and too much spending is what caused the problem in the first place.

Tips for Staying Debt Free after debt settlement

Life after credit card debt settlement will in many ways be easier than before you began our debt settlement program. Before, you carried the burden of debt and watched your income become swallowed up by bills. Prior to enrolling in our program, perhaps you found yourself reaching for credit cards to buy groceries and taking cash advances to pay your mortgage. Life after debt settlement will not have these anxieties. But, that doesn’t necessarily mean that it is going to be a breeze either.

Congratulations, you have won a battle against your debt, but it is now time to win the war. The enemy has retreated, but only your continued hard work and determination can really obliterate the opposition. In many ways, this is where the hard work really begins. You must ensure that you don’t end up in the same position as you were when you enrolled in our debt settlement program. If you are still unemployed or living on a reduced income, this might mean doing odd jobs or having a garage sale to make some cash and avoid using credit. Hopefully if our debt settlement program has taught you anything at all, it is the importance of saving. Now is the time to continue saving and building up that rainy day fund, so in the event of car trouble or personal injury, you don’t have to go back into debt.
